My favorite part of From Hell is the afterword, "Dance of the gull catchers" where Alan Moore talks about why he wrote the comic as well as the history of Ripperology.
|
# ? Nov 29, 2023 14:30 |
|
muscles like this! posted:My favorite part of From Hell is the afterword, "Dance of the gull catchers" where Alan Moore talks about why he wrote the comic as well as the history of Ripperology. It's probably the best essay on Jack the Ripper ever written. From Hell is obviously great and unlikely to be beat as the best Ripper fiction every written (not to mention visually presented), but Dance stands even taller than it because the it carries more weight and meaning. From Hell can get bogged down in Moore's mysticism (sorry Alan, it's not impressive that five points can make a pentagram since that's true of any five points that are not on a line) even as it tries to integrate everything into a cohesive story, even the contradictoey parts. Dance is a lot more sober and realostoc and self-reflective. You can't have Dance of the Gull Catchers without From Hell, but I think it stands apart.

Just to be clear, I'm not against horny comics, I love good horny comics. Hell, I recommended an extremely horny comic on this very page. Vampi has definitely had good talent thrown at her for years with varying results. The lows heavily outweigh the highs but I get it, when it's good, it's very good. That said, I think there's a huge difference comparing a new Vampi kickstarter with a Lady Death or Zombie Tramp kickstarter. I also want to be clear that I'm not at all saying they shouldn't keep doing these. They make absolutely massive amounts of money for the creators and unlike other campaigns that never really get fulfilled (*coughComicsGatecoughcough*) so obviously there's a market. I'm just curious why there's a market. The current campaign has ~1900 backers and ~256k committed to it. That's around $130 per backer. I know it's a little skewed because they have extremely expensive tiers but if you exclude those and their backers, that just drops the average to $120. Am I missing something? Is there some real secondary market for the variants that I don't know about?
